STATEMENT OF THE JOB
Perform professional law enforcement and crime prevention work involved in the protection of life and property enforcing State, Federal, Municipal laws and regulations. Work is performed in accordance with departmental and City rules and regulations, and patrol officers receive assignments and instructions from officers of higher rank. Assignments include uniformed patrol, traffic control, technical and staff service, administration, special support team activities, and investigative work. Work requires exercise of initiative and independent judgment in routine and emergency situations involving exposure to potential injury or loss of life. Work methods and results are evaluated by superior officers through personal inspections, review of reports, and discussions. Work is subject to rotating shift assignments, irregular hours, holiday assignments, and on-call status

PHYSICAL DEMANDS / WORK ENVIRONMENT
PHYSICAL DEMANDS :
The work environment characteristics described here are representative of those an employee encounters while performing the essential functions of this job.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essentials functions. While performing the duties of this job, the employee is required to pick up or raise the knee up to a suspect in the peroneal nerve or other motor points; maintain balance after being pushed or shoved; remove another person from danger, e.g. drag the weight of an average size adult body (165 lbs. based on P.O.P.A.T. standards) for 32 feet; lift an average size adult onto a stretcher; to pursue a person over a variety of terrain for a block or more in distance; crawl on hands and knees for the purpose of looking under houses, vehicles or furniture; climb stairs, ladders, fences and riverbanks; operate the police radio, spotlight, overhead lights, siren, and drive the vehicle in a safe manner at the same time; exit vehicle with items in hands, e.g., flashlight or baton; kneel then quickly return to a standing position as would be required in a take-down method; grip an object, arm, baton, or weapon tightly with both hands. Specific hearing abilities include ability to hear the sound of gunfire, muffled screams, cries for assistance, glass breaking, squealing tire, and radio alert tones.
